Java和JDBC編程是IT行業(yè)中非常重要的兩個(gè)方面。Java作為一種面向?qū)ο蟮木幊陶Z(yǔ)言,被廣泛應(yīng)用于軟件開發(fā)和企業(yè)級(jí)應(yīng)用程序的開發(fā)。而JDBC作為Java的一個(gè)API,可以實(shí)現(xiàn)Java與數(shù)據(jù)庫(kù)的無(wú)縫連接,是實(shí)現(xiàn)數(shù)據(jù)庫(kù)操作必不可少的組成部分。如果你想深入了解Java和JDBC編程方面的知識(shí),可以通過(guò)觀看視頻來(lái)學(xué)習(xí)。
import java.sql.Connection; import java.sql.DriverManager; import java.sql.PreparedStatement; import java.sql.ResultSet; import java.sql.SQLException; public class JdbcExample { private static final String DATABASE_URL = "jdbc:mysql://localhost:3306/mydb"; private static final String DATABASE_USERNAME = "root"; private static final String DATABASE_PASSWORD = "password"; public static void main(String[] args) throws ClassNotFoundException, SQLException { String sql = "SELECT * FROM mytable WHERE id = ?"; try (Connection connection = DriverManager.getConnection(DATABASE_URL, DATABASE_USERNAME, DATABASE_PASSWORD); PreparedStatement statement = connection.prepareStatement(sql) { statement.setInt(1, 1); ResultSet resultSet = statement.executeQuery(); while (resultSet.next()) { int id = resultSet.getInt("id"); String name = resultSet.getString("name"); System.out.println("id: " + id + ", name: " + name); } } } }
以上是一個(gè)簡(jiǎn)單的JDBC實(shí)例,連接到MySQL數(shù)據(jù)庫(kù)并查詢表中id為1的數(shù)據(jù),然后將結(jié)果輸出到控制臺(tái)。可以通過(guò)學(xué)習(xí)視頻,深入了解JDBC編程各個(gè)方面的知識(shí),包括連接數(shù)據(jù)庫(kù)、執(zhí)行SQL語(yǔ)句、處理結(jié)果集等等,對(duì)提升自己的編程能力非常有幫助。
上一篇jquery 通訊錄樣式
下一篇java 和c 的if